  • After an obvious imbalance in injector performance in a leak off test, bad fuel economy and excess smoke the injector #2 was changed with a reconditioned unit. The replacement injector was coded to the Ecu before test drive and follow up leak off test(that was curious in itself). Economy has greatly improved, smoke is all but gone and idle is fine. Engine still hesitant between 1600-2000rpm while feathering throttle so will look into replacing MAF. Clutch and intake manifold will be done in near future as DMF noise and clutch position and swirl flaps deleted but suspect gunged up intake after cleaning Egr and Throttle body

      @@maciejkuzma8186 before you delete swirl flaps check your intercooler has no leaks. If your intercooler is leaking boost you will have poor idle, smoke and bad performance. If you remover undertrays you can inspect the intercooler from underneath the car. Other common issues with Z19DTH is Egr needing cleaned or Swirl flap control bar is not operating correctly. If the swirl flap bar is worn the flaps can be bonded open with instant metal or JB weld. If bonding the swirl flaps open, really clean well the area and cover the swirl caps with your product so you do not have boost leaks that will cause smoke/poor performance. Check you have no cuts or breaks in vacuum lines to boost control solenoid and from intercooler to throttle body. Anything can be fixed, the z19dth is a good engine. Also check your oil level is not too high as oil may be passing piston rings causing smoke/performance issues

      @@maciejkuzma8186 I would advise clean air filter, clean EGR valve and run a fuel cleaner through the system to ensure injectors are spraying correctly. When the engine is warm and driven hard poorly spraying injectors won't smoke but when cold they may. It could simply be condensed moisture being burned out of the catalytic converter, DPF or exhaust system when starting from cold depending on where you are in the world. Here in Scotland it is common to see vapour and exhaust gasses staring a cold diesel engine. Let me know if you figure out the problem, I would be interested to know if you find the fault. If you can do an injector leak off test, this would let you see if you have an injector issue or it is something else. I have an leak off test on my channel that shows I had a faulty injector

      On your injectors they all have a code made up of numbers and letters that should be coded to the ECU of the car. It will run but perhaps not as efficiently as it could if not coded to the car. The number is located on the top part of the injector and most garages can code them in a matter of minutes with a professional diagnostic tool. In the UK they generally charge £40/50 to do so.
